배포
다음 단계를 완료하여 배포 구성을 업데이트합니다.
* 
최적의 결과를 얻으려면 최대 권장 값을 따르는 것이 좋습니다.
1. ThingWorx Software Content Management의 왼쪽 창에서 관리 섹션 아래의 구성 > 배포로 이동합니다.
배포 구성 페이지가 나타납니다.
2. 성능 구성, 시간 초과 구성, 지침 기반 구성, 자동 재시도, 업로드 섹션에서 업데이트할 필드에 적합한 값을 입력하고 저장을 클릭합니다.
배포를 위한 성능 구성 매개 변수
매개 변수
설명
기본값
동시 다운로드
파일을 동시에 다운로드할 수 있는 파일 기반 패키지에 대한 배달 대상의 최대 수입니다.
* 
이 매개 변수는 지침 기반 패키지에 적용되지 않습니다. 이 설정 값은 지침 기반 패키지의 다운로드 지침에 의해 시작된 다운로드에 어떠한 영향도 주지 않습니다.
* 
동시 배포 수는 ThingWorx Composer에서 FileTransferSubsystem구성 페이지에서 파일 전송 풀에 할당된 최대 스레드 수의 값을 초과할 수 없습니다. 파일 전송 풀에 할당된 최대 스레드 수의 값을 60으로 설정할 것을 권장합니다.
50
* 
최대 권장 값은 200입니다.
동시 알림
파일 기반 패키지에 대해 '보류 중' 상태를 '알림 중' 상태로 전환하고 동시에 파일 기반 패키지에 대해 '보류 중' 상태를 '지침 전송 중' 상태로 전환할 수 있는 배달 대상의 최대 수입니다.
50
* 
최대 권장 값은 100입니다.
최대 활성 배달 대상
활성 상태에서 허용되는 모든 패키지에 대한 배달 대상의 최대 수입니다.
활성 상태는 다음과 같습니다.
알리는 중
알림
예약됨
다운로드 중
다운로드됨
설치 중
지침 전송
지침 수신
50
* 
최대 권장 값은 500입니다.
* 
지침 기반 패키지의 경우, 동시 알림최대 활성 배달 대상 값이 적용됩니다.
파일 기반 및 지침 기반 패키지에서 공통으로 사용되는 시간 초과 구성 매개 변수
* 
시간 초과가 발생할 경우 작업이 중단됨 또는 대시도 상태로 이동합니다.
매개 변수
설명
기본값
대기 중 시간 초과(초)
대기 중인 시간 초과(초)입니다.
86400
설치 시간 초과(초)
설치 시간 초과(초)입니다.
3600
재시도 대기 중 시간 초과(초)
재시도 대기 중인 시간 초과(초)입니다.
3600
* 
파일 전송이 활성화되어 있는 동안에는 설치 중 상태의 배포는 시간 초과되지 않습니다.
파일 기반 패키지에 대한 시간 초과 구성 매개 변수
* 
시간 초과가 발생할 경우 작업이 중단됨 또는 대시도 상태로 이동합니다.
매개 변수
설명
기본값(초)
알림 시간 초과(초)
알림 시간 초과(초)입니다.
120
알림 완료 시간 초과(초)
예정된 다운로드 날짜가 지난 배달 대상에 대한 알림 완료 시간 초과입니다.
60
예약 시간 초과(초)
예약 시간 초과(초)입니다.
60
다운로드 시간 초과(초)
다운로드 시간 초과(초)입니다.
3600
다운로드 완료 시간 초과(초)
예정된 설치 날짜가 지난 배달 대상에 대한 다운로드 완료 시간 초과(초)입니다.
120
* 
파일 전송이 활성화되어 있는 동안에는 다운로드 중 상태의 배포는 시간 초과되지 않습니다.
지침 기반 패키지에 대한 구성 매개 변수
* 
시간 초과가 발생할 경우 작업이 중단됨 또는 대시도 상태로 이동합니다.
매개 변수
설명
기본값(초)
지침 수신 시간 초과(초)
지침 수신 시간 초과(초)입니다.
3600
지침 전송 시간 초과(초)
지침 전송 시간 초과(초)입니다.
* 
지침 전송 시간 초과(초) 매개 변수의 값은 자산이 손실(즉, isReporting 속성의 값이 false와 같음)되는 데 필요한 시간보다 커야 합니다.
86400
다운로드 대상 저장소
지침 기반 패키지 다운로드에 대한 기본 저장소를 구성합니다. FileRepository 사물 템플릿을 구현하는 ThingWorx 저장소를 지정합니다.
TW.RSM.Thing.FileRepository
자동 재시도를 위한 구성 매개 변수
매개 변수
설명
기본값
사용 가능
패키지 배포를 자동으로 재시도할 수 있도록 하려면 이 확인란을 선택합니다. 이 기능을 사용하지 않으려면 이 확인란의 선택을 취소합니다.
True
연결이 끊긴 대상에 대해 자동으로 재시도
이 확인란을 선택할 경우: 대상 자산이 연결되었는지 여부에 관계 없이 패키지 배포를 재시도합니다. 대상 자산이 자동 재시도 속도 및 구성된 재시도 횟수에 따라 결정된 시간 프레임 내에 온라인 상태가 되면 배포가 진행됩니다. 그렇지 않을 경우, 자산에 대한 배포가 시간 초과되어 중단됩니다.
이 확인란을 선택하지 않은 경우: 자산의 연결이 끊기면 대상 자산에 대한 배포가 즉시 중단됩니다. 재시도가 발생하지 않습니다.
True
간격당 최대 자동 재시도 횟수
자동 재시도를 시작할 때 배달 대상(자산) 재시도의 최대 수입니다. 이 최대값을 너무 높게 설정할 경우 성능이 저하될 수 있습니다.
500
기본 최대 자동 재시도 횟수
ThingWorx Utilities 사용자 인터페이스에서 배포에 대한 기본 최대 재시도 횟수를 표시하는 데 사용되는 글로벌 기본값입니다.
예를 들어, 이 값은 일회성 배포 만들기 페이지의 자동 재시도 섹션에 있는 횟수 필드에 나타납니다.
5
자동 재시도 속도
자동 재시도 타이머 간격(초)입니다. 여기에서 지정한 속도로 실행되는 이 타이머로 재시도 프로세스가 시작됩니다. 예를 들어, 기본 속도는 30초마다입니다. 즉, 타이머가 30초마다 적합한 배달 대상(자산)에 대한 적합한 배포를 재시도하기 위해 자동 재시도 프로세스를 트리거합니다.
15초와 1000000초 사이의 값을 지정할 수 있습니다. 유효하지 않은 값을 지정할 경우 가장 가까운 유효 값이 고려됩니다.
* 
동시 배포와 관련된 문제를 방지하려면 자동 재시도 타이머 간격을 최소 300초로 설정하는 것이 좋습니다.
30
* 
ThingWorx Software Content Management 9.3.16의 경우 이 값은 31입니다.
ThingWorx Software Content Management 9.5.1 및 9.6.0의 경우 이 값은 47입니다.
업로드에 대한 구성 매개 변수
매개 변수
설명
기본값
전체 업로드 체크섬 필요
플랫폼에서 업로드된 파일의 체크섬에 대한 유효성을 검사해야 하는지 여부를 지정합니다.
False
도움이 되셨나요?